Nurbank Joins the 'Isker Aymak' Program

Nurbank has become a participant in the Unified Small Business Support Program "Isker Aymak", implemented by the Damu Fund. Under the program, the bank will provide financing to entrepreneurs with the possibility of subsidizing part of the interest rate.

The program aims to ensure affordable financing for micro and small business entities in priority sectors, including manufacturing, food production, and furniture, as well as craftsmanship.

The program provides for loan subsidies for investment purposes and working capital replenishment. The maximum loan amount is up to 200 million tenge, with a subsidy period of up to 3 years. The state covers 40% of the reward rate.

"Participation in the 'Isker Aymak' program expands the bank's capabilities in financing small and medium-sized businesses, including in regions. We are witnessing a steady demand from entrepreneurs for affordable credit resources and tools to reduce borrowing costs," commented Nurbank's press service.
